New Hidden Messages Found In Da Vinci's Mona Lisa! Posted: 12 Jan 2011 12:30 PM PST Last month, we reported that Now, Italian researcher Silvan Vinceti says he's found a letter "S" in Mona Lisa's left eye, and an "L" in her right eye. He also says he's found a number "72" under the "arched bridge in the backdrop" of the painting. According to Vinceti, the symbols he found are "very small, painted with a tiny brush and subjected to the wear and tear of time." So what do these symbols mean? Vinceti believes the "S" could refer to the woman who ruled Milan during the Sforza dynasty, where Leonardo da Vinci spent time between 1482-1499 and 1506-1507. As far as the "L" is concerned, Vinceti says it stands for "Leonardo." With regards to "72," Vinceti claims it's a pertinent symbol from Kabbalah and Christianity. He says the "7" has lots of symbolic associations such as creation of the world, and he says the "2" could refer to the duality of male and female. Are U aware of this, Dan Brown? Sarah Palin Responds To Arizona Shooting And… Posted: 12 Jan 2011 11:30 AM PST Sometimes, people rise above after they've done wrong to admit their fault. This is not one of those moments. Sarah Palin released a video this morning, responding to the backlash she's been receiving in regards to the Arizona shooting last Saturday. In case you don't know, last year, Sarah released a deplorable graphic on her Facebook page. It was a map of the USA, covered in crosshairs, targeting areas and politicians that supported the new health care reform. One of those names was Gabrielle Giffords, the congresswoman who was shot in the head over the weekend. No one has proved as of yet that Jared Loughner's attack on the Congresswoman had anything to do with Sarah Palin or the Tea Party movement, but like many others, we called into question Sarah's ease to use violently suggestive images as a means to garner support.
